Sea Coast in Normandy
Courbet's style in "Sea Coast in Normandy" is quintessentially Realist. He focuses on accurately representing everyday life and landscapes without idealization or romanticism. This approach is evident in the detailed depiction of the rocks, sand, boats, and clouds, which together create a sense of realism.
